Direct connections fail on some networks (symmetric NAT, strict firewalls). Point this at your own TURN server — e.g. a self-hosted coturn — and connections fall back to relaying through it. Only one side needs it configured. Details stay in this browser and are never sent to the other peer.
Incoming files are written to browser storage as they arrive so an interrupted transfer can resume. They're removed automatically once a file is saved to disk.
🔒 Files travel directly between devices over an encrypted WebRTC channel and are verified with SHA-256. The server only helps the two sides find each other.
